Autor | Zpráva | ||
---|---|---|---|
Měsíček Profil |
#1 · Zasláno: 7. 2. 2008, 16:43:10 · Upravil/a: Měsíček
Chtěl bych slyšet váš názor na tuhle podivnost na kterou jsem náhodou natrefil, určitě znáte CSS vlastnost "font-weight" a také určitě víte jak s ní zachází prohlížeč hodnotu "900" vykreslí stejně jako "bolder" podle Specifikace
jsou možné pouze tyhle hodnoty: normal | bold | bolder | lighter | 100 | 200 | 300 | 400 | 500 | 600 | 700 | 800 | 900 | inherit dříve jsem si myslel, že může být i "333" nebo "899", ale každý prohlížeč hodnotu jinou než 10x-90x vykreslí zase normálně to znamená, že i když hodnota 900 vykreslí text jako tučný hodnota 901 nebo 899 už ne, z toho mi vyplívá, že to není ani povoleno a ve specifikaci jsem o tom nenašel ani zmínku, také mi k tomu naznačuje to, že specifikace přímo odděluje svislou čárkou | kdyby to bylo jinak mohla by klidně napsat 100 - 900, .. z toho jsem tedy usoudil, že 901 nebo 899 je špatně, stejný názor na to má prohlížeč, teď, ale jsem se snažil tohle ověřit ve validátoru a ejhle dostal jsem zajímavé výsledky například: Projde : b {font-weight: 101;} b {font-weight: 899;} b {font-weight: 999;} Neprojde : b {font-weight: 1000;} b {font-weight: 99;} z toho se dají usoudit jen dvě možnosti: 1.) Validátor CSS "jigsaw" má nový bug 2.) Nebo jsou povoleny i hodnoty jako například 899 i když na prohlížeč to nemá žádný vliv a odporuje to logice. Co si o tom myslíte vy? |
||
Chamurappi Profil |
#2 · Zasláno: 7. 2. 2008, 17:40:45
Reaguji na Měsíčka:
Oficiální CSS validátor se dopouští mnoha chyb, toto je jedna z nich. Už mám rozepsaný vlastní. |
||
Měsíček Profil |
#3 · Zasláno: 7. 2. 2008, 17:41:47
Oficiální CSS validátor se dopouští mnoha chyb, toto je jedna z nich.
Tak přece jen :) aspoň jednou jsem netrefil vedle. Už mám rozepsaný vlastní. Už se těším, kdy nastoupí? |
||
Manq Profil |
#4 · Zasláno: 7. 2. 2008, 17:44:06
Už se těším, kdy nastoupí?
Už další generace Měsíčků by v něm možná mohla zkoušet své stránky :o)). Chamurappi Takže už ses naučil validovat CSS? Někde jsi psal, že to neumíš. |
||
Railbot Profil |
#5 · Zasláno: 7. 2. 2008, 18:12:37
Už další generace Měsíčků by v něm možná mohla zkoušet své stránky :o)).
Takže příští měsíc po novém cyklu? ;) |
||
Chamurappi Profil |
#6 · Zasláno: 7. 2. 2008, 18:51:33
Reaguji na Měsíčka:
Veřejný betatest bude možná v dubnu. Reaguji na Manqa: Ano, psal jsem, že CSS zatím validovat neumím. Když zná stylopisy oficiální jednorožec, nesmí ten můj zůstat pozadu :-) |
||
Časová prodleva: 8 dní
|
|||
Měsíček Profil |
#7 · Zasláno: 15. 2. 2008, 14:40:48
Jen jsem se chtěl ještě zeptat smí být hodnota u vlastnosti "font-weight" dvojitá to znamená tohle:
font-weight: 300 bolder; něco o tom je tady, že nejspíše ano: The computed value of "font-weight" is either: one of the legal number values, or one of the legal number values combined with one or more of the relative values (bolder or lighter). This type of computed values is necessary to use when the font in question does not have all weight variations that are needed. ,ale jak říkám nechci z toho vyvozovat blbý názory .. jinak samozřejmě CSS validátor mi to neuznal. |
||
Manq Profil |
#8 · Zasláno: 15. 2. 2008, 14:46:06
Máš před "or" čárku. To znamená poměr vylučovací. Myslím tedy, že platná je pouze jedna hodnota. Mimochodem, jak myslíš, že by potom font-weight fungovala? Bylo by písmo tučné 300, nebo bolder? Obojí asi těžko, ne?
|
||
Měsíček Profil |
#9 · Zasláno: 15. 2. 2008, 14:48:09
Mě právě zmátl tady tento úsek : "one of the legal number values combined with one or more of the relative values (bolder or lighter). ".
|
||
Měsíček Profil |
#10 · Zasláno: 15. 2. 2008, 14:52:39
Tak a teď jsem zmaten kompletně :)))
V knize od Erica Meyera píše : Vypočtená hodnota: Jedna z číslených hodnot (100 atd.) nebo jedna z číselných hodnot plus jedna z relativních hodnot (bolder nebo lighter). |
||
Bubák Profil |
#11 · Zasláno: 15. 2. 2008, 16:20:29
Tak a teď jsem zmaten kompletně
My víme ;-) Buď se EM nepřesně vyjádřil, nebo pravděpodobněji chyba překladu. |
||
Časová prodleva: 16 let
|
0